Family therapists believe most life difficulties stem from: correct answers Family Problems Family therapy is particularly effective with: correct answers Adult Obesity and Couple Distress Before 1940, mental health treatment focused on: correct answers Individuals The systems theory developed by Ludwig Von Bertanlanffy had less reliance on _________ and more emphasis on ______________. correct answers linear causality; circular causality The only woman pioneer in the early days of family therapy was: correct answers Virginia Satir A type of questioning developed by the Milan Associates, emphasized asking questions that highlighted differences among family members. This type of questioning is called: correct answers circular questioning The following family therapy pioneer utilized touch and nurturing of family members, emphasizing self-esteem, compassion, and affective congruence: correct answers Virginia Satir There are currently two associations accrediting marriage and family therapy training programs: correct answers CACREP & AAMFT Family therapy focuses on the ___________ rather than the ___________, which creates new and unique ways of resolving problems. correct answers Interpersonal; intrapersonal Family therapy tends to be ___________ than individual counseling. correct answers briefer (T/F) In the 1970s, feminists began to question whether or not some concepts of family therapy were oppressive to women. correct answers True (T/F) The purpose of mystification is to simultaneously send two seemingly contradictory messages, leading to confusion. correct answers False (T/F) The first family therapy license was granted in Michigan in 1963. correct answers False (T/F) John Bell was known for his unconventional, spontaneous, sometimes outrageous appearing approaches, designed to help families achieve freedom and growth. correct answers False (T/F) The most popular family therapy approaches in the 1970s were experiential family therapy, structural family therapy, and strategic family therapy. correct answers True
